MS-PROJECT EXERCISE

An aerospace company has received a contract from NASA for the final assembly of a space module for an upcoming mission. The Project Manager has identified two types of critical resources, engineers and technicians that are needed in the project. Following table lists the project tasks, their precedence relationships, durations, material cost and resource requirements. The indicated resources are needed for the duration of each task.

For example 3 engineers and 7 technicians are needed during the 30 days of task time for Task A and a half time engineer and 1 technician are needed for the 30 days of task duration for Task C.

  • Schedule the project from the project start date August 24, 2020
  • Use Work Breakdown Structure and Gantt Chart.
  • Five engineers and 15 technicians are available for the duration of the project.
  • Use the number when assigning engineers and technicians (i.e., Eng 1, Eng 2,... Eng 5; Tech 1, Tech 2, Tech 3, ... Tech 15)
  • Use the task label when assigning material costs (i.e., Material A, Material B, ..., Material K).
  • Put material, engineers, and technicians in the Resource Sheet.
  • Engineers and technicians are paid at the rate of $100/hour and $35/hour, respectively. Any overwork is paid 1.5 times.
  • Engineers and Technicians hourly rate will be increased to $135, and $45, respectively, in two months.
  • Engineers are few (only five) but there are many tasks to be done. Overtime will take place. Your job is to minimize the overtime of workers (that is, to minimize the total costs) by efficiently allocating resources (engineers and technicians) to the task.
